Department Overview

Cook 1 positions prepare simple foods according to standardized menus, recipes, or verbal instructions given by supervisor; makes salads, dressings, gelatin, toast, or sandwiches; grills sandwiches, burgers, bacon, pancakes, eggs, French toast, and hash browns and toast; cleans, cuts, and chops vegetables and fruits; slices meats, cheeses, and breads; cuts desserts; adjusts recipe quantities to eliminate excessive waste of food products; fills drink machines, mixes beverages, makes coffee, and prepares sack lunches or snacks; uses various types of commercial kitchen equipment such as mixers, slicers, and choppers; prepares simple desserts such as pudding, cobbler, and loaf cakes; slices and wraps bread and other baked items; checks for proper temperature of prepared foods with thermometer; observes food to be sure it is visually appealing and of high quality. Cleans various equipment and work stations, cleans drawers, utensils. Adheres to sanitation and food safety standards. Interacts with customers and fellow employees in a professional courteous manner.

Additionally, you may transport food back and forth from the kitchen to the cafes, clean tables, mop floors, stock utensils, cups and beverages. Serve food from steam tables, fill 5 gallon buckets of ice for the soda machines, lift 30-50lb boxes of soda syrup and clean equipment.
